Surface area Prep work



Prior to painting your home, see to it to extensively prepare the surfaces by cleaning and fixing any type of blemishes. Beginning by cleaning the walls with a mild detergent remedy to eliminate dust, dust, and grease. Use a sponge or cloth to scrub gently, making sure all surface areas are clean and dry prior to proceeding.

Inspect the wall surfaces for any splits, holes, or peeling off paint. Fill in any voids with spackling substance, sanding it smooth once completely dry. For bigger openings, take into consideration making use of a patch kit for a smooth surface.

Next off, thoroughly inspect the trim, walls, and crown molding. Clean them down with a damp towel to remove any crud or residue. Look for any dents or scratches that require to be filled and fined sand.

Don't ignore the ceilings-- clean them completely and attend to any type of flaws before painting.

Shade and Complete Option



To attain the wanted aesthetic for your home, very carefully select the shades and finishes that will certainly improve the overall feel and look of each space. When selecting shades, take into consideration the mood you intend to create in each area. Lighter shades can make an area really feel more roomy and airy, while darker tones can add heat and comfort. Consider the all-natural light that gets in the room and just how it may influence the color throughout the day.



In addition to shade, the surface of the paint is likewise critical. Matte surfaces can conceal blemishes however might be more difficult to clean, while satin and semi-gloss surfaces are a lot more sturdy and cleanable. Glossy coatings can add a touch of style yet may highlight imperfections in the wall surfaces.

Keep in mind that various spaces may gain from various color pattern and coatings based upon their feature and the environment you want to create.

Furnishings and Design Security



Consider covering your furniture and decor things to secure them from paint splatters and trickles throughout the expert painting process. Use plastic drop cloths or old bedsheets to shield your items from unintended spills.

Relocate furniture to the center of the room or right into another location away from the wall surfaces being painted. If transferring large products isn't feasible, group them with each other and cover with safety materials.

For smaller sized decoration pieces, remove them from the area totally if practical. If eliminating them isn't a choice, carefully wrap them in plastic or towel to prevent paint damage.

Pay unique focus to electronic devices and valuable products that could be easily ruined by paint.
